Google Advances Gemini AI Agent Strategy

Google is reportedly building an advanced AI agent under its Gemini ecosystem, aimed at performing complex, multi-step tasks autonomously.

May 6, 2026
|

A strategic push into autonomous AI systems is taking shape as Google develops a new agent designed to rival emerging platforms like OpenClaw. The initiative signals intensifying competition in the AI agent space, with implications for enterprise productivity, digital assistants, and the broader evolution of human-computer interaction.

Google is reportedly building an advanced AI agent under its Gemini ecosystem, aimed at performing complex, multi-step tasks autonomously. The system is designed to compete with next-generation agent platforms such as OpenClaw, which focus on action-oriented AI rather than passive responses.

The agent is expected to integrate deeply with Google’s existing services, enabling capabilities such as task automation, workflow management, and real-time decision-making. Internally, the project is seen as part of Google’s broader effort to evolve its AI offerings beyond chat-based interfaces. The development highlights a shift toward AI systems capable of executing actions rather than simply generating content.
